Introduction of Coins

The New Orleans Mint underwent a lull in half dollar production during 1857. While 818,000 coins hardly make for a rarity, this issue is somewhat scarce in the higher circulated grades and genuinely rare in Mint State. Gems are remarkably elusive and will be found only in the most advanced collections. Typically, 1857-O half dollar are found well struck from dies that were not overused or overpolished. The Bugert die register for New Orleans half dollars identified six obverses paired with three reverses, for a total of eight die marriages. All 1857-O half dollars were struck with a single collar gauge having 140 reeds.
